Not far away from where we live is the Dupont State Forest in North Carolina. It encompasses a bounty of lush cascading waterfalls along the Little River—Hooker Falls, Triple Falls, and High Falls—whose claim to fame is that they were chosen for filming part of “The Hunger Games.”

This time of year is particularly scenic. The Brevard area and Transylvania County boast more than 250 waterfalls, and recent rains have turned all of them into gushing fountains. On blistering hot days in the summertime, you can kick off your shoes for wading or don a swimsuit for a slippery dip into pools of Coke-ad-worthy refreshment.
